Pular para o conteúdo principal

Get Current User Profile

GET 

/auth/me

Retorna a informação completa do perfil do usuário autenticado. Fluxo Típico:

  1. O cliente envia uma solicitação com o token JWT no cabeçalho de Autorização
  2. O servidor valida o token e extrai o ID do usuário
  3. Consulta os dados atualizados do usuário no banco de dados
  4. Retorna a informação completa do perfil Casos de Uso:
  • Carregamento das informações do usuário ao iniciar o aplicativo
  • Exibição dos dados do perfil na interface do usuário
  • Validação das permissões e função do usuário atual
  • Sincronização de dados após atualizações Informações Retornadas:
  • Dados pessoais (nome, sobrenome, e-mail)
  • Informações da empresa associada
  • Função e permissões do usuário
  • Tipo de assinatura ativa
  • Data de criação da conta Notas Importantes:
  • Requer um token JWT válido no cabeçalho: Authorization: Bearer {token}
  • O token não deve estar expirado (válido por 24 horas)
  • Retorna os dados mais recentes do banco de dados
  • Não inclui senha ou informações sensíveis

Responses

Perfil do usuário recuperado com sucesso